Transaction 73ddb59471c126e31bebb12bb1d0d3b4633d0b153857ee69f5aa8bc263be60e4

1 Input
2 Outputs
  • 73ddb59471c126e31bebb12bb1d0d3b4633d0b153857ee69f5aa8bc263be60e4:0
  • value  9400000
    address  17RgHc5Gf85eXRRxkMoUsD8y5NALrPHzSM
  • 73ddb59471c126e31bebb12bb1d0d3b4633d0b153857ee69f5aa8bc263be60e4:1
  • value  43290170
    address  15JmXWwTgXUEuVBpdVBTAqWNeYyVPvP7sr